The Future of Payment Solutions and Careers at Visa
The onset of the global pandemic served as a catalyst for the rapid adoption of digital payment solutions, fundamentally altering consumer behavior and expectations. In response to these changes, Visa has enhanced its technology and expanded its service offerings to meet the increasing demand for contactless payments, mobile wallets, and peer-to-peer transfer services. This shift towards digitalization is not merely a temporary trend; it represents a long-term change in how transactions are conducted worldwide. Visa's commitment to innovation is evident in its strategic investments in emerging technologies. The company is exploring the potential of blockchain technology to enhance security and transparency in transactions while facilitating faster cross-border payments. These advancements indicate a future where traditional payment systems are either augmented or entirely replaced by decentralized technologies, paving the way for a more efficient and secure payment landscape.
Emerging Trends in Payment Solutions
The growing popularity of cryptocurrencies has prompted Visa to take proactive steps to incorporate these digital assets into its payment ecosystem. By partnering with cryptocurrency platforms, Visa allows customers to convert digital coins into traditional currency at the point of sale. This integration not only caters to an expanding demographic of cryptocurrency users but also signifies a broader acceptance of alternative currencies within mainstream commerce. Blockchain technology, with its decentralized nature, offers Visa opportunities to enhance transaction processes significantly. By leveraging blockchain, Visa can streamline operations, reduce fraud, and improve transaction speeds. This technological shift is expected to create new roles focused on blockchain development, security, and regulatory compliance within Visa, emphasizing the need for professionals who can navigate this emerging landscape. Artificial intelligence (AI) is revolutionizing the payment sector by providing valuable insights into consumer behavior and transaction patterns. Visa utilizes machine learning algorithms to detect fraudulent activities in real time, ensuring secure transactions and enhancing customer trust. As AI technology continues to advance, it will create new career pathways for data scientists, machine learning engineers, and AI specialists within the organization, driving further innovation.
Career Opportunities at Visa
The transformation in payment solutions is generating a wealth of job opportunities at Visa. Here are some key areas where aspiring employees can focus their efforts: With an increasing emphasis on data-driven decision-making, skills in data analytics, statistics, and programming languages such as Python and R are becoming increasingly valuable. Visa seeks professionals who can interpret complex data sets to inform business strategies, enhance customer experiences, and drive innovation. A strong foundation in data science will be essential for those looking to make an impact within the organization. As digital payments gain prevalence, the demand for robust cybersecurity measures intensifies. Visa is actively seeking cybersecurity experts who can safeguard sensitive data and protect against emerging threats. Candidates with backgrounds in information security, risk management, and compliance will be well-positioned for careers in this critical field, ensuring that Visa remains a trusted provider of payment solutions. With ongoing innovations in payment platforms, Visa requires skilled software developers proficient in cloud computing, mobile app development, and API integration. Expertise in programming languages such as Java, C++, and JavaScript will be essential for those looking to contribute to Visa's technological advancements. As the company continues to push the boundaries of payment technology, skilled developers will play a crucial role in shaping its future.

Blockchain Developer
Visa, Ripple, IBM, ConsenSys
Core Responsibilities
Design and implement blockchain-based solutions to improve transaction security and efficiency.
Collaborate with cross-functional teams to integrate blockchain technology into existing payment systems.
Conduct research on emerging blockchain protocols and technologies to identify potential applications for Visa.
Required Skills
Proficiency in languages such as Solidity, Go, or JavaScript, with a strong understanding of blockchain frameworks like Ethereum or Hyperledger.
Experience in cryptography and security principles related to blockchain technology.
Familiarity with regulatory considerations and compliance associated with blockchain implementations.
Fraud Detection Analyst
Visa, PayPal, American Express, Mastercard
Core Responsibilities
Analyze transaction data using machine learning algorithms to identify and mitigate fraudulent activities in real-time.
Develop and maintain fraud detection models and refine existing ones based on evolving threats.
Collaborate with cybersecurity teams to strengthen overall security measures and response strategies.
Required Skills
Strong analytical skills with experience in statistical analysis and data visualization tools such as Tableau or Power BI.
Proficiency in programming languages like Python or R, with a focus on machine learning techniques.
Knowledge of payment systems and fraud trends within the financial services industry.

Cybersecurity Compliance Specialist
Visa, Deloitte, PwC, FireEye
Core Responsibilities
Develop and enforce security policies and procedures to ensure compliance with industry regulations and standards.
Conduct security audits and risk assessments to identify vulnerabilities and recommend remediation measures.
Collaborate with legal teams to interpret regulations and ensure that payment solutions meet compliance requirements.
Required Skills
In-depth knowledge of cybersecurity frameworks (NIST, ISO 27001) and compliance regulations (PCI DSS, GDPR).
Strong analytical and problem-solving skills, with experience in risk management and incident response.
Relevant certifications such as CISM, CISSP, or CEH are preferred.
